As your first point of contact as an academic representative, I am adamant to make sure that student feedback is acknowledged at the university. As a first year myself, I recognise the support needed when starting your course, whether it be on how to keep up with the new style of learning at university, or looking to further your education with related workshops; I would love to collaborate with the department and faculty officers to represent student interests when meeting up with the committee and develop my skills in leadership and organisation. I know this role comes with commitment but I believe I have the skills and determination present to successfully represent other Politics and Economics students to the extent that they deserve.

Having done a JP Morgan summer school in August 2022 and being a prefect in my last school, I believe this role would showcase and enhance my communication and team working skills. Enriching our academic environment as your Economic, Social and Political Science School President would be a great pleasure to me and I would love to prove myself to my fellow students by representing what matters to you.
